We are seeking a Senior Software Engineer to join a major digital transformation program focused on modernising enforcement and infringement processing across multiple Australian jurisdictions.
This is a hands-on role for someone who enjoys building smart automation, integrating systems, and using data and AI to improve how large-scale operations run.
You will play a key role in designing, building and deploying software solutions that improve the speed, accuracy and scalability of enforcement workflows, while working closely with operational, technology and reporting teams.
What you will be doing
* Design, build and deploy automation solutions across complex business workflows
* Develop front-end tools that make investigative and enforcement work faster and easier
* Integrate enterprise platforms such as Salesforce, reporting tools, and case management systems via APIs and data pipelines
* Build and maintain RPA bots, ETL pipelines, and automation frameworks
* Use AI and analytics to improve processing volumes, accuracy and decision-making
* Lead the full software lifecycle: solution design, development, testing and deployment
* Translate business problems into scalable, high-quality technical solutions
* Support governance, compliance and data integrity requirements
What we're looking for
* Bachelor's degree in Software Engineering, Computer Science, Mathematics or similar
* 5+ years' experience in software engineering, automation, or business transformation
* Strong coding skills in Python, JavaScript or similar
* Experience building web-based interfaces (e.g. React, Streamlit)
* Strong experience with APIs, system integrations, ETL pipelines and automation
* Strong communication and stakeholder engagement skills